@gibsondcxpl85
@gibsondcxpl85 10 дней назад
@@NightOwlStvdiosThe Shaws sound a little dull here, similar to what I experienced with my ‘85 LP. They really opened up with 500k pots, much more clarity. The original volume pots were under 300k and I think the tone pots about 150k 😮. You said you wanted to leave yours stock, but you won’t regret upgrading to a 500k wiring harness, the original pots are the culprit, not the pickups

@ericlebeau1604
@ericlebeau1604 10 месяцев назад
Why do you measure action from the fretboard instead of the top of the fret? That will be inconsistant from guitar to guitar depending on fret height. On a given guitar, it should work but from one to another not.
@NightOwlStvdios
@NightOwlStvdios 10 месяцев назад
You are right, the proper way is on the fret itself. It works out for me because all of my LPs have the same fret height. I have to go higher on my strat style guitars as well since they are taller frets. Thank you for watching, great comment!
